DOW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2022 in Review

1,545 of the 6,340 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Dow Inc (DOW) for Q1 2022, worth a combined $30.2B — up 10% from $27.4B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 190 funds opened new DOW positions and 102 closed out — a net gain of 88 holders — while 673 added to existing stakes and 439 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$85.9M. The largest seller was Capital International Investors, cutting an estimated $598M.
